§ 111080. — 111080. (Amended by Stats. 2006, Ch. 538, Sec. 425.)

California·Code HSC Health and Safety Code - HSC·Div. 104. DIVISION 104. ENVIRONMENTAL HEALTH·Part 5. PART 5. SHERMAN FOOD, DRUG, AND COSMETIC LAWS·Ch. 5. CHAPTER 5. Food·Art. 12. ARTICLE 12. Bottled, Vended, Hauled, and Processed Water

The quality and labeling standards requirements for bottled water and vended water, including mineral water, shall include all standards prescribed by Section 165.110 of Title 21 of the Code of Federal Regulations. In addition, bottled water and vended water, when bottled, shall comply with the following quality standards and any additional quality standards adopted by regulation that the department determines are reasonably necessary to protect the public health:

(a)Bottled water and vended water shall meet all maximum contaminant levels set for public drinking water that the department determines are necessary or appropriate so that bottled water may present no adverse effect on public health.
